What is Methadone?
Methadone is a synthetic opioid agonist for Opioid Use Disorder (OUD). Many people in recovery rely on methadone as part of their treatment program.
However, methadone can be addictive when misused. You should always take methadone under a healthcare professional’s supervision to prevent unwanted side effects.

How Does Methadone Work?
Methadone binds with brain receptors activated by other opioids like heroin and morphine. It reduces cravings and withdrawal symptoms.
Opioid-dependent people who take methadone don’t experience the same kind of euphoria. One of methadone’s benefits is its long duration of action, allowing it to have a slow onset and prolonged effect.

Forms of Methadone
Various forms of methadone are available, depending on your treatment plan. Your doctor can also determine the best methadone form suitable for you.
Here are the common forms of methadone:3
- Tablet: Methadone tablets are taken orally. You can swallow it whole or mix it in water if it's a dispersible tablet.
- Liquid: You can also take methadone as a liquid. This is usually prescribed to those with difficulty swallowing tablets or capsules. The liquid concentrate contains 10 milligrams of methadone per milliliter.
- Injection: Methadone can also be administered as an injection. It’s an alternative for those who can't take oral medication.
How Long Does Methadone Treatment Usually Last?
It’s recommended to stay on methadone treatment for at least 12 months.4
Some may even be on methadone treatment for 20 years.5 This is because opioid addiction is a chronic condition that requires ongoing to prevent relapse.
Other factors that affect the duration of methadone treatment include:
- The severity of the addiction
- Your response to the treatment
- Overall health
- Specific recovery goals
Once you’ve achieved stability, gradually tapering the methadone dose is essential. It helps minimize any withdrawal symptoms.

Possible Side Effects and Risks of Methadone
Methadone also comes with possible side effects and risks. These side effects will vary for everyone depending on their body’s reaction to the drug.
According to the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A), common side effects of methadone include:1
- Nausea and vomiting
- Restlessness
- Slow breathing
- Itchy skin
- Heavy sweating
- Constipation
- Sexual problems
- Mood swings
- Mental clouding
These side effects and risks are why gradual tapering of methadone is essential. It allows you to adjust to fewer doses, reducing the risk of severe side effects.
